Hungary: The Miracle of Cserdi

Published by:

A long article on Laszlo Bogdan, the mayor of the small village of Cserdi in the South Western part of the country. He has been fighting against unemployment and getting the people of the village, of which 75% are Roma to work. He did so with methods that are often controversial and authoritarian, and the work is mostly manual and in the agriculture. He is also very much against the Roma establishment and politicians, who, he says have pocketed millions from the EU without doing anything.
Can his model be expanded?

The Auschwitz Painter

Published by:

The family of Dina Babbitt, an Auschwitz survivor who dies in 2009 and, while in Auschwitz was forced to paint portraits of other inmates, is trying to recover her art. Seven portraits of Roma she painted are know to have survived the war.

Festival of another Kind

Published by:

On the 16th of August, in the Banská Bystrica Historic Town Hall, the largest Roma multi-ethnic event in Central Slovakia will be opened. It is called “Ľudia z rodu Rómov” [People of the Roma family] and will last until the 19th of August. A non-traditional home-based exhibition focusses on Roma women and their position in society in connection with the growing extremism and radicalism is part of the festival.

“The individual activities of the festival will be held in three cities – Banská Bystrica, Zvolen, Sliac and visitors can enjoy outstanding Roma artists from Slovakia, the Czech Republic, Hungary and Romania,” said Denisa Sciranková from Quo Vadis civic association.

Slovakia, Roma, and Work

Published by:

Representatives of municipalities and non-profit organizations will share their positive experiences with Roma employment in the green economy in Košice. The workshop takes place on the 15th of August in Teledom on Timonova Street, will also include experts from Norway.

“The European Environment Committee has estimated that up to 860’000 new full-time jobs could potentially be generated by waste management – logistics, repair, sales and recycling by 2030. If this ambitious scenario could be met by reducing food waste, re-using textiles, furniture and recycling, by 2020, 425 million tonnes of CO2 emissions would be released into the European atmosphere and almost 61 million litres of water would be saved,” said Slavek Mačáková, Director of ETP Slovakia.

For Slovakia, this could mean an estimated 10,000 jobs and save our air from five million tons of CO2 and save 600,000 litres of water.

Stolpersteine in Salzburg

Published by:

A report on the “Stolpersteine” in Salzburg, the small stones on the pavement commemorating the victims of the Holocaust. In Salzburg, there are a dozen of stones devoted to Roma, even though they were the largest victim group in that city.
Needless to say, these memorials are still controversial in Austria.

French Chronicle …

Published by:

Dire statistics on Roma in France: 4’382 Roma were expulsed in France in the first six months of the year from 50 camps or squats, 2’689 by the police, 867 after a fire, and 796 “voluntarily”… they haven’t been re-lodged, which is against the French law. This cat and mouse play has been lasting for serval years. In Marseilles, an article shows the impact of such constant expulsions on the families, while in Paris, the Roma in Montreuil are still on the street, a year after their expulsion. The fate of a family from Montenegro which will be expulsed gives a face to these policies.
